A young fan of Ray Chen has been busking every day for the past few weeks, to save up money to buy tickets to see him in concert.

Allen Wang, 7, has been playing the violin for two years, and is a big fan of the Taiwanese-Australian virtuoso.

When Chen was told about Wang’s mission to see him in concert, he decided to give the young violinist a wonderful surprise.

“THIS IS SO CUTE!!” Chen wrote on Twitter, posting a video of the seven-year-old.

“Seven-year-old Allen Wang has been busking extra hard for the past few weeks to save up money for tickets to my concert!”

Touched by his enthusiasm, Chen invited Wang – who lives in Los Angeles – to watch him in a recital at the Walt Disney Concert Hall on 6 November. The violinist also included a VIP backstage tour, and tickets for Wang’s family.

“I’m so touched!” Chen wrote on Twitter. “Allen, you’re getting a VIP backstage tour and additional tickets for your family!”

Wang, who studies at the Colburn Community School of Performing Arts in LA, has admitted he loves Ray Chen, and would love to play Bach’s Double Violin Concerto with him one day.

“Ray Chen is really funny. I think he’s really good at the violin. I really, really, really, really want to play with Ray Chen,” he says in a video on his dad’s YouTube account.
